Albert Randall Shewmaker, 82, Bardstown

Albert Randall Shewmaker, 82, of Bardstown, died Sunday, May 27, 2012, at Hardin Memorial Hospital in Elizabethtown. He was born July 27, 1929, in Woodlawn, retired from Owens-Illinois as an electrician and mechanic. His hobbies included antiques and woodworking. He was a member of First Christian Church (Disciples of Christ).

He was preceded in death by his parents, Will Turner Shewmaker and Anna Lucille Janes Shewmaker; one sister, Lucille Stewart; and three brothers, Leroy Shewmaker, Jimmy Shewmaker, and Guy Shewmaker.

He is survived by his wife of 60 years, Beulah Mae Stone Shewmaker of Bardstown; one son, William Randall Shewmaker and his wife Lynn Shewmaker of Bloomfield; one daughter, Saundra Lucille Noe and her husband Fred Noe; three grandchildren, Freddie Noe, Krista Shewmaker Durbin, and Linsey Ann Shewmaker, all of Barsdtown; one great-grandchild, Jamie Alan Durbin of Bardstown; and several nieces and nephews.

There will be a private memorial service at a later date. Memorial contributions may go to First Christian Church (D.O.C.).

Barlow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ements. For more information, please visit http://www.barlowfh.com/.
